Experimental study for frequency spectrum of turbulent boundary layer pressure fluctuation

An experimental study on TBL (turbulent boundary layer) pressure fluctuation frequeny spectrum of a revolution body is presented. With the measured results, a relation of convective frequency fo of the models is obtained. Relations of turbuleat wall-pressure fluctuation spectrum in transition region and development region to frequency and speed are obtained also 展开更多

An ab initio theoretical study of the optical spectrum of CF_2

The ab initio calculation methods have been used to calculate the spectral and electronic characteristics of difluorocarbene in the ground electronic state(~1A_1),the lowest-lying singlet(~1B_1)and triplet(~3B_1)states,The optimized equilibrium geometries,rotational constants,harmonic vibrational frequencies and energy gaps,electronic charges,dipole moments of these states have been computed with different basis sets.The calculated vibrational frequency of ~3B_1 state(v_2=522 cm^(-1))and the energy separation(2.26eV)between ~3B_1 and ~1A_1 states are in good agreement with the experimental re- sults(519 cm^(-1),2.46 eV respectively).According to the calculations the previous assignment of vibrational symmetries of ~1B_1 state was corrected,and some experimentally undetermined vibrational frequencies were predicted. 展开更多
